Investors are likely to keep an eye on the following small-cap stocks listed on the Australian Securities Exchange.
S2 Resources (ASX:S2R)
S2 Resources confirmed the presence of prominent multi-element hotspots during follow-up sampling in two of four soil anomalies at the West Murchison project in Western Australia. Meanwhile, an initial gravity survey at the Warraweena project in New South Wales identified three distinct geophysical targets in an unexplored area beneath cover.
ECS Botanics (ASX:ECS)
The medicinal cannabis cultivator and manufacturer secured an increase to its corporate loan facility with the National Australia Bank (ASX:NAB) to AU$3.2 million from AU$2 million. Also, the company is set to launch its first product using the VESIsorb delivery system, which will improve onset, absorption, and efficiency in cannabis-based products.
Great Boulder Resources (ASX:GBR)
Great Boulder Resources agreed to sell its 100% interest in the Whiteheads project in Western Australia to Great Western Gold.
West Cobar Metals (ASX:WC1)
West Cobar Metals confirmed a large interval of antimony-copper mineralization and identified four new priority diamond drill hole targets at the Bulla Park project in New South Wales. Meanwhile, drill planning is underway for four iron oxide copper-gold targets at the Fraser Range exploration in Western Australia.
Auric Mining (ASX:AWJ)
Auric Mining started processing ore from Jeffreys Find gold mine at its Three Mile Hill plant in Western Australia with its joint venture partner BML Ventures of Kalgoorlie, expecting a minimum of 40,000 tonnes to be milled in the first campaign.
